Description

The London Borough of Merton has recently implemented Servelec's MOSAIC as its case and information management IT system for social care in both adults and children's services.
The Council is looking to secure some additional capacity and expertise to support practitioners through the process of transitioning to the new system and to help embed the system firmly into the organisation's routine business.

Successful provider will be required to have capacity to meet the council's service requirements as they emerge on a 'call off' basis through the provision of expertise both in knowledge and experience of the implementation of MOSAIC in local authorities, with an emphasis on change management and process design.
